Volkswagen has turned the Polo into a battery-electric hatchback with real small-car logic: front-wheel drive, two battery chemistries, DC fast charging as standard, and up to 454 km / 282 miles of WLTP range. The Volkswagen ID. Polo starts in Germany at about $29,300, while early orders open with the higher-output Life trim at about $39,600.

Why does the Volkswagen ID. Polo matter?

The new ID. Polo matters because Volkswagen finally puts a familiar mass-market name on a compact EV instead of asking buyers to decode another number badge. That matters for trust. More than 20 million Polos have reached customers since 1975, so Volkswagen knows this car carries expectations around affordability, durability, and daily usability.

Looking at the data, the ID. Polo targets the exact hole many automakers left open: a normal-size electric hatchback that does not ask families to buy an SUV for basic EV practicality. It measures 4,053 mm long, 1,816 mm wide, and 1,530 mm tall, or roughly 159.6 inches long, 71.5 inches wide, and 60.2 inches tall. That footprint lands slightly shorter than the gasoline Polo, yet the EV offers a longer wheelbase at 2,600 mm, or 102.4 inches.

From an expert perspective, this tells the story. Volkswagen used the MEB+ platform and front-wheel-drive packaging to push the cabin outward, free up rear space, and increase cargo volume. The result gives buyers a compact EV that should feel bigger than its exterior length suggests.

How much range and power does the ID. Polo offer?

The 2027 Volkswagen ID. Polo range depends on battery chemistry and motor output. The cheaper 37 kWh versions use LFP battery chemistry, while the 52 kWh version uses NMC battery chemistry for longer driving range and higher output.

ID. Polo version Battery Power Horsepower equivalent Max DC charging WLTP range
ID. Polo 85 kW 37 kWh LFP 85 kW 116 PS 90 kW Up to 329 km / 204 miles
ID. Polo 99 kW 37 kWh LFP 99 kW 135 PS 90 kW Up to 329 km / 204 miles
ID. Polo 155 kW 52 kWh NMC 155 kW 211 PS 105 kW Up to 454 km / 282 miles

Specifically, the 37 kWh battery charges from 10 to 80 percent in about 23 minutes, while the 52 kWh pack takes about 24 minutes. That charging curve matters more than the peak number. A 90 kW or 105 kW rating sounds modest beside 800V EVs, but this battery size does not need huge power to add useful range quickly.

In addition, every version tops out at 160 km/h / 99 mph. That limit fits the mission. Volkswagen did not build this car for Autobahn bragging rights; it tuned the ID. Polo for efficiency, urban duty, and regional trips.

LFP vs. NMC batteries

LFP batteries usually cost less, tolerate frequent charging well, and work nicely in entry EVs. NMC batteries usually deliver higher energy density, which helps range. In the ID. Polo, Volkswagen uses LFP for value trims and NMC for the long-range 155 kW model.

Is the ID. Polo actually practical?

Yes. The ID. Polo cargo space gives the strongest proof. Volkswagen lists 441 liters / 15.6 cubic feet of trunk space, up from 351 liters in the gasoline Polo. Fold the rear seatbacks and capacity rises to 1,240 liters / 43.8 cubic feet, versus 1,125 liters for the conventional model.

Measurement ID. Polo Gasoline Polo What it means
Length 4,053 mm / 159.6 in 4,074 mm / 160.4 in EV is slightly shorter
Width 1,816 mm / 71.5 in 1,751 mm / 69.0 in EV has a wider stance
Height 1,530 mm / 60.2 in 1,451 mm / 57.1 in EV packaging adds vertical space
Wheelbase 2,600 mm / 102.4 in 2,552 mm / 100.5 in EV gives more cabin length
Trunk volume 441 L / 15.6 cu ft 351 L / 12.4 cu ft EV gains 25 percent
Seats folded 1,240 L / 43.8 cu ft 1,125 L / 39.7 cu ft Better small-family utility

Consequently, the ID. Polo looks like a more honest urban-family EV than many tall, expensive crossovers. A 441-liter trunk can handle grocery runs, school gear, and a weekend bag load without turning the back seat into overflow storage.

What features come standard?

Volkswagen keeps the cabin conventional where it should. The ID. Polo interior uses a 10-inch Digital Cockpit, a 13-inch Innovision infotainment screen, physical buttons, rotary controls, and standard automatic climate control. That choice matters because touch-only controls have annoyed enough Volkswagen buyers already.

Standard and available hardware includes:

  • DC fast charging on every trim
  • One-Pedal Driving for stronger regenerative braking control
  • Side Assist, Lane Assist, and Emergency Assist
  • Available Connected Travel Assist with traffic light recognition
  • Available IQ.LIGHT LED matrix headlights
  • Available Harman Kardon 425-watt audio system
  • Available panoramic glass roof
  • Available 12-way power front seats with pneumatic massage

By comparison, many small EVs still feel built to hit a price, then ask buyers to forgive cheap cabin decisions. The ID. Polo looks more serious. Volkswagen gives it hardware from larger segments, then uses traditional controls to reduce daily friction.

Can the ID. Polo power equipment or tow?

Yes, and this detail deserves attention. The ID. Polo offers Vehicle-to-Load capability as standard, supplying up to 3.6 kW to external devices. That can run e-bikes, outdoor equipment, or campsite gear through an interior 230V socket or a charging-port adapter.

The ID. Polo can also support a ball coupling with a 75 kg / 165 lb drawbar load and tow up to 1,200 kg / 2,646 lb on an 8 percent gradient, depending on version. That does not turn it into a towing hero. It does make it useful for a small trailer, bike carrier, or lightweight weekend setup.

Pro-Tip: Which ID. Polo should buyers target?

Pick the 37 kWh LFP version for city use, short commutes, and low running costs. Pick the 52 kWh NMC version for frequent highway driving, winter range margin, and fewer charging stops. The long-range model costs more, but range anxiety costs time every week.

How much does the ID. Polo cost?

Volkswagen lists the German base price at 24,995 euros, equal to about $29,300. The launch-order ID. Polo Life with the 155 kW motor and 52 kWh battery starts at 33,795 euros, or about $39,600.

German price Approx. USD conversion Model context
24,995 euros $29,300 Base ID. Polo, due later in summer
33,795 euros $39,600 ID. Polo Life, 155 kW, 52 kWh battery

That conversion does not equal a confirmed US MSRP. Volkswagen has announced German pre-sales, not a North American launch. For US readers, the smarter takeaway comes from positioning: Volkswagen wants the ID. Polo to reset the entry EV price discussion in Europe first.

The new Volkswagen ID. Polo looks like the compact EV Volkswagen should have built years ago: familiar name, sensible packaging, fast enough charging, real trunk space, and pricing that starts below many larger EVs. Its biggest weakness for North America remains availability. Until Volkswagen confirms a US plan, this car works as a market signal rather than a shopping-list entry.

The ID. Polo proves one point clearly: the next EV growth wave will not come from heavier, pricier SUVs alone. It will come from efficient small cars that make the math work.
